Stagecoach, Nevada has an estimated population of 1,892, a decrease from the 2,022 recorded in the 2020 Census. The population is 82.7% White, 9.5% Hispanic, 5.5% Multiracial, 1.4% Black, 1.0% Native American/Other, and 0.0% Asian. This demographic dot map shows the population of Stagecoach, with one dot drawn for each person counted by the Census, color-coded by race.

Stagecoach has become considerably less racially diverse since the 2020 Census. It is considerably less diverse than Nevada overall. Demographers use a diversity index to measure the probability that two randomly selected individuals belong to different racial or ethnic groups. In Stagecoach, that probability was 35.6% in 2020 and 30.4% in the most recent ACS estimates.

Stagecoach is ranked the 46th most populous place in Nevada, out of 132 places. This ranking is based on the Census definition of a place, which includes incorporated places like cities, towns, and villages, as well as unincorporated census-designated places (CDPs). Stagecoach was ranked the 46th most populous place in the 2020 Census.

Stagecoach's White Population

1,564 residents of Stagecoach, or 82.7% of the population, identify as White. The share of White residents in Stagecoach is significantly higher than in Nevada overall, where 44.8% of the population is White. Stagecoach ranks 60th statewide in terms of White residents as a share of the population, out of 132 places.

Since the 2020 Census, Stagecoach's White population has declined by an estimated 2.4%. White residents' share of Stagecoach's population has increased from 79.3% to 82.7%.

Stagecoach is more White than neighboring Dayton (72.8% White), Silver City (64.4% White), and Fernley (66.9% White). Stagecoach is less White than neighboring Silver Springs (83.8% White), and Virginia City (91.1% White).

Stagecoach's Hispanic Population

179 residents of Stagecoach, or 9.5% of the population, identify as Hispanic. The share of Hispanic residents in Stagecoach is significantly lower than in Nevada overall, where 29.6% of the population is Hispanic. Stagecoach ranks 73rd statewide in terms of Hispanic residents as a share of the population, out of 132 places.

Since the 2020 Census, Stagecoach's Hispanic population has declined by an estimated 9.6%. Hispanic residents' share of Stagecoach's population has remained roughly unchanged at 9.5%.

Stagecoach is more Hispanic than neighboring Silver Springs (5.6% Hispanic), Virginia City (6.5% Hispanic), and Silver City (4.2% Hispanic). Stagecoach is less Hispanic than neighboring Dayton (20.6% Hispanic), and Fernley (21.6% Hispanic).

Stagecoach's Multiracial Population

104 residents of Stagecoach, or 5.5% of the population, identify as Multiracial. The share of Multiracial residents in Stagecoach is comparable to the share in Nevada overall, where 6% of the population is Multiracial. Stagecoach ranks 15th statewide in terms of Multiracial residents as a share of the population, out of 132 places.

Since the 2020 Census, Stagecoach's Multiracial population has declined by an estimated 30.7%. Multiracial residents' share of Stagecoach's population has decreased from 7.4% to 5.5%.

Stagecoach is more Multiracial than neighboring Dayton (2.8% Multiracial), and Virginia City (2.3% Multiracial). Stagecoach is less Multiracial than neighboring Silver Springs (7.5% Multiracial), Silver City (31.4% Multiracial), and Fernley (7.1% Multiracial).
